Primary ResponsibilitiesThe Data and Training Specialist supports the Senior Director and Early Education team in implementing the Early Childhood Literacy Readiness Program for Nevada Ready! State Pre-K programs and other United Way of Southern Nevada (UWSN) early childhood initiatives. This position provides administrative, technical, and programmatic support to ensure the effective delivery of services and successful outcomes for participating teachers, administrators, and UWSN staff.
The Data and Training Specialist is responsible for managing educational and programming data, delivering technical assistance, developing and facilitating professional learning opportunities, and supporting the effective use of instructional and student information systems. The role analyzes student achievement and program performance data to identify trends, measure impact, and inform continuous improvement efforts.
Working collaboratively with educators and stakeholders, the Data and Training Specialist develops training materials, conducts workshops and coaching sessions, and promotes data-driven instructional practices that enhance teaching quality and improve student outcomes. Through effective data management, professional development, and program support, this position contributes to the successful implementation and measurable impact of UWSN's early childhood education initiatives.
